Trivia / Lavender Castle

Go To

  • Screwed by the Network: CITV didn't heavily promote the series on its original broadcast, and wasn't repeated until 2005, which gave it a new resurgence in popularity and making it popular enough to warrant a DVD release of all the episodes.
  • Screwed by the Lawyers: The whole series is classified as this. Carrington Productions International sold distribution rights to HIT Entertainment, whose treatment and the later purchase of Carrington by Entertainment Rights made a second season impossible, although it was planned. The rights have since gone on to NBCUniversal, who acquired DreamWorks Animation (the then-owners of the Entertainment Rights/Classic Media library) in 2016, and according to Jamie Anderson (Gerry's son), he has tried numerous times to acquire the series from NBCUniversal but to no avail. At one point in 2017, a company called Little Dot Studios (A YouTube network owned by All3Media) began copyright-claiming episodes of the series on YouTube, likely due to the website's broken copyright system.
